/*
 * @(#) ObjectConverterManager.java
 *
 * Copyright 2002 - 2003 JIDE Software. All rights reserved.
 */
package com.jidesoft.converter;

import java.awt.*;
import java.io.File;
import java.util.Calendar;
import java.util.Date;

/**
 * A global object that can register converter with a type and a ConverterContext.
 */
public class ObjectConverterManager {

    private static CacheMap _cache = new CacheMap(ConverterContext.DEFAULT_CONTEXT);

    private static ObjectConverter _defaultConverter = new DefaultObjectConverter();

    /**
     * Registers a converter with the type specified as class and a converter context specified as context.
     *
     * @param clazz     the type of which the converter will registered.
     * @param converter the converter to be registered
     * @param context   the converter context.
     */
    public static void registerConverter(Class clazz, ObjectConverter converter, ConverterContext context) {
        if (clazz == null) {
            throw new IllegalArgumentException("Parameter class cannot be null");
        }

        if (context == null) {
            context = ConverterContext.DEFAULT_CONTEXT;
        }

        if (isAutoInit() && !_initing) {
            initDefaultConverter();
        }

        _cache.register(clazz, converter, context);
    }

    /**
     * Registers as the default converter with type specified as clazz.
     *
     * @param clazz     the type of which the converter will be registered.
     * @param converter the converter to be registered
     */
    public static void registerConverter(Class clazz, ObjectConverter converter) {
        registerConverter(clazz, converter, ConverterContext.DEFAULT_CONTEXT);
    }

    /**
     * Unregisters converter associated with clazz and context.
     *
     * @param clazz   the type of which the converter will be unregistered.
     * @param context the converter context.
     */
    public static void unregisterConverter(Class clazz, ConverterContext context) {
        if (context == null) {
            context = ConverterContext.DEFAULT_CONTEXT;
        }

        if (isAutoInit() && !_initing) {
            initDefaultConverter();
        }

        _cache.unregister(clazz, context);
    }

    /**
     * Unregisters converter associated with clazz.
     *
     * @param clazz the type of which the converter will be unregistered.
     */
    public static void unregisterConverter(Class clazz) {
        unregisterConverter(clazz, ConverterContext.DEFAULT_CONTEXT);
    }

    /**
     * Unregisters all the converters which registered before.
     */
    public static void unregisterAllConverters() {
        _cache.clear();
    }

    /**
     * Gets the registered converter associated with class and context.
     *
     * @param clazz   the type of which the converter will be registered.
     * @param context the converter context.
     * @return the registered converter.
     */
    public static ObjectConverter getConverter(Class clazz, ConverterContext context) {
        if (isAutoInit()) {
            initDefaultConverter();
        }

        if (context == null) {
            context = ConverterContext.DEFAULT_CONTEXT;
        }

        ObjectConverter converter = _cache.getRegisteredObject(clazz, context);
        if (converter != null) {
            return converter;
        }
        else {
            return _defaultConverter;
        }
    }

    /**
     * Gets the converter associated with the type.
     *
     * @param clazz type
     * @return the converter
     */
    public static ObjectConverter getConverter(Class clazz) {
        return getConverter(clazz, ConverterContext.DEFAULT_CONTEXT);
    }

    /**
     * Converts an object to string using default converter context.
     *
     * @param object object to be converted.
     * @return the string
     */
    public static String toString(Object object) {
        if (object != null)
            return toString(object, object.getClass(), ConverterContext.DEFAULT_CONTEXT);
        else
            return "";
    }

    /**
     * Converts an object to string using default converter context.
     *
     * @param object object to be converted.
     * @param clazz  type of the object
     * @return the string
     */
    public static String toString(Object object, Class clazz) {
        return toString(object, clazz, ConverterContext.DEFAULT_CONTEXT);
    }

    /**
     * Converts an object to string using converter context sepcified.
     *
     * @param object  object to be converted.
     * @param clazz   type of the object
     * @param context converter context
     * @return the string converted from object
     */
    public static String toString(Object object, Class clazz, ConverterContext context) {
        ObjectConverter converter = getConverter(clazz, context);
        if (converter != null && converter.supportToString(object, context)) {
            return converter.toString(object, context);
        }
        else if (object == null) {
            return "";
        }
        else {
            return object.toString();
        }
    }

    /**
     * Converts from a string to an object with type class.
     *
     * @param string the string to be converted
     * @param clazz  the type to be converted to
     * @return the object of type class which is converted from string
     */
    public static Object fromString(String string, Class clazz) {
        return fromString(string, clazz, ConverterContext.DEFAULT_CONTEXT);
    }

    /**
     * Converts from a string to an object with type class using the converter context.
     *
     * @param string  the string to be converted
     * @param clazz   the type to be converted to
     * @param context converter context to be used
     * @return the object of type class which is converted from string
     */
    public static Object fromString(String string, Class clazz, ConverterContext context) {
        ObjectConverter converter = getConverter(clazz, context);
        if (converter != null && converter.supportFromString(string, context)) {
            return converter.fromString(string, context);
        }
        else {
            return null;
        }
    }
